New World Music/ Dance Appreciation

Our world music and dance courses are an opportunity to learn about a wide range of styles and genres, from folk music of Europe, to folk and classical traditions across the non-Western world. World music: an introduction explores traditions from India, Africa, the Middle East and the Americas in the cultural contexts of their country of origin as well as their diaspora and cross-cultural fusions. The other courses we offer are practical, allowing you to experience singing, playing and dancing the many styles yourself.
